Sostrin Client Spotlight - Stuart Crichton

Not everyone can say that they’ve worked on four Grammy-nominated projects over a thirty-three-year career as a songwriter, producer, and audio mixer—but Stuart Crichton isn’t just anyone.  His credits include songs and remixes for a range of chart-topping artists, including Tiësto, the “Godfather of EDM” (Electronic Dance Music); “Princess of Pop” Kylie Minogue; and the highest selling boyband in music history, the Backstreet Boys.

Mr. Crichton comes from a musical family in his native Scotland.  He began playing the cello when he was 7 years old, and spent his school years in various orchestras, before joining local pop bands.

“I put my first self-released record out in 1989,” he notes, after starting to create electronic music in 1987.  As an artist, Mr. Crichton released music under various names, including as a member of the electronic dance duo Narcotic Thrust, which won an International Dance Music Award for their song “I Like It.”

Mr. Crichton began writing and producing songs in the 1990s for multi-platinum selling artists such as the Pet Shop Boys and the Sugababes.

In 2015, Mr. Crichton and his family moved to the United States.  He explains, “We were living in Australia, and I decided that I had to have one big push to have some major success, so we decided to uproot ourselves and come to LA.”

Since his move, Mr. Crichton has achieved several major successes, writing and producing songs for some of the most recognizable names in pop music like Selena Gomez, Louis Tomlinson, Delta Goodrem, Stan Walker, Gin Wigmore, and DNCE.

Chief among his recent musical achievements, Mr. Crichton was involved in bringing back the Backstreet Boys, writing and producing songs on their 2019 album DNA, including the group’s lead hit single, “Don’t Go Breaking My Heart.”  The song received a Grammy Award nomination, making it the band’s first nomination since 2002, while the album became the group’s first number one release since 2000.  For this feat, Mr. Crichton was featured in Rolling Stone and Billboard, two of the most influential music magazines in the United States.

Mr. Crichton also received Grammy Award nominations for his brilliant musicmaking with such acclaimed artists as Kygo, Toni Braxton, and Kesha.
